Hiroyuki Kawai is a scholar working on Electrical and Electronic Engineering, Computer Networks and Communications and Geophysics. According to data from OpenAlex, Hiroyuki Kawai has authored 18 papers receiving a total of 492 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Electrical and Electronic Engineering, 11 papers in Computer Networks and Communications and 4 papers in Geophysics. Recurrent topics in Hiroyuki Kawai’s work include Wireless Communication Networks Research (9 papers), Advanced Wireless Communication Techniques (6 papers) and Seismic Waves and Analysis (4 papers). Hiroyuki Kawai is often cited by papers focused on Wireless Communication Networks Research (9 papers), Advanced Wireless Communication Techniques (6 papers) and Seismic Waves and Analysis (4 papers). Hiroyuki Kawai collaborates with scholars based in Japan and United States. Hiroyuki Kawai's co-authors include Eiichi Fukuyama, Mizuho Ishida, Douglas S. Dreger, Atsuki Kubo, Kenichi Higuchi, Mamoru Sawahashi, Takumi Ito, Hiroyuki Seki, Koji Nii and Naoya Watanabe and has published in prestigious journals such as Tectonophysics, IEEE Journal of Solid-State Circuits and Earth Planets and Space.
